Portugal honey
An Atlantic-Mediterranean hybrid with an unusual monofloral range for its size — rosemary and lavender from the interior, eucalyptus from the coastal plantations, chestnut from the north, and rockrose and strawberry tree from the scrub.
How honey is produced here
Portugal holds a large number of protected designations for honey relative to its production volume, covering the Barroso, Alentejo, Ribatejo and several other regions. Eucalyptus plantations established for pulpwood have become a major and somewhat uncomfortable part of the honey landscape.

Honeys from Portugal
- Rosmaninho honeyLight amber · ModerateAromatic and resinous with a warm herbal sweetness and a faint eucalyptus lift — more robust and less perfumed than Provençal lavender honey.
- Eucalyptus honeyExtra light amber · ModerateWoody and faintly medicinal, with caramel and a cool eucalypt lift. More savoury than its colour suggests.
- Blue gum honeyLight amber · PronouncedStrongly medicinal and camphoraceous with a caramel base — the flavour most people mean when they say a honey tastes of eucalyptus.
- Rockrose honeyLight amber · PronouncedBalsamic and resinous with a warm amber sweetness underneath — it smells of incense and hot scrubland, and tastes considerably less sweet than its colour suggests.
- Strawberry tree honeyAmber · IntenseAggressively bitter — coffee grounds, artichoke and burnt sugar, with the sweetness arriving late and briefly. Nothing in food prepares most people for it.
- Chestnut honeyAmber · IntenseAromatic, woody and unmistakably bitter — sweetness first, tannin second, and a long dry finish.
- Tree heath honeyAmber · IntenseStrong, malty and slightly bitter, with a burnt-caramel depth and a woody finish — assertive in a way that divides opinion sharply.
- Carob honeyAmber · IntenseDark, malty and distinctly savoury with a fermented, almost cheesy note that people either find fascinating or cannot get past.
- Almond blossom honeyLight amber · PronouncedDistinctly bitter with a marzipan aroma over it — one of the few honeys where bitterness arrives before sweetness, and an acquired taste even among people who like bitter honeys.
- Ivy honeyExtra white · PronouncedStrong, faintly bitter and distinctly herbal — closer to a dark honey in character than its pale colour suggests.
- Holm oak honeydew honeyDark amber · IntenseDark, savoury and barely sweet, with malt, liquorice and a genuine salt-mineral depth. As far from what people expect honey to be as anything in the catalogue.
- Cardoon honeyLight amber · PronouncedSavoury and faintly bitter, with a warm caramel body and an unmistakable green-vegetable note that is genuinely artichoke-like.
Plants behind these honeys
- RockroseCistus ladaniferAn outstanding pollen source and a good nectar one, and a plant that also supplies resin for propolis — an unusual triple contribution.
- EucalyptusEucalyptusProlific in both nectar and pollen when flowering, though the pollen of some species is nutritionally poor for honey bees, and colonies confined to a single eucalypt species can suffer over time despite abundant forage.
- LavenderLavandula angustifoliaAn unusually good nectar plant relative to its pollen offering. Bees visiting lavender are mostly there for nectar, which is why it supports adult foragers well and contributes less to brood rearing.
- Strawberry treeArbutus unedoValuable out of all proportion to its abundance, because of when it flowers. Late nectar lets colonies enter winter with fresh stores in a landscape that has otherwise shut down.
- Sweet chestnutCastanea sativaAn exceptional pollen source — the catkins shed enormous quantities — and a good nectar source in the right weather. The pollen arrives at a useful moment for colonies building towards late summer.

- Bell heatherErica cinereaA good nectar source and moderate for pollen, over a long summer season on ground with few alternatives.
- CarobCeratonia siliquaStructurally important rather than abundant — a good nectar source at a time of year when a Mediterranean colony has almost no alternatives.
- AlmondPrunus dulcisTop-rated for both, at the single most valuable moment of the year for a colony coming out of winter. That is precisely why the pollination market exists.
- IvyHedera helixOne of the very few plants that is top-rated for both nectar and pollen, and it delivers them when the year's other options have finished. For overwintering insects this is decisive.
Bees associated with this origin
- Western honey beeApis melliferaThe bee behind essentially all the world's honey, and the one most people mean when they say 'bee'. Apis mellifera is a perennial eusocial insect that overwinters as a living cluster rather than dying back each year — which is the whole reason it stores honey in quantity, and therefore the reason it was ever domesticated. It is native to Europe, Africa and western Asia and has been carried by people to every continent except Antarctica.
- BumblebeesBombusLarge, furry, loud, and cold-tolerant in a way no honey bee is. Bumblebees run annual colonies: a mated queen emerges alone in spring, founds a nest by herself, raises workers through the summer, produces new queens and males in late season, and then the entire colony dies except those new queens. They do make honey, in the strict sense of ripened nectar stores — just a few days' worth, because they have no winter to survive as a colony.
- Iberian honey beeApis mellifera iberiensisThe honey bee of Spain and Portugal, and one of the more genetically interesting subspecies in Europe — it carries ancestry from both the western European dark bee lineage and the African lineage across the Strait of Gibraltar, in a gradient running from north to south. It is defensive, frugal, prone to swarming, and superbly adapted to a landscape of long dry summers.
- Mining beesAndrenaSolitary ground-nesting bees, and the small volcano-shaped mounds of fine soil that appear on lawns and bare paths in April are theirs. Mining bees are the classic spring solitary bees of the northern hemisphere: short-lived, entirely harmless, often nesting in dense aggregations that look like a colony but are not, and a great many of them are specialists that visit only one kind of flower.
- Blue orchard beeOsmia lignariaNorth America's managed mason bee, and the species increasingly deployed alongside honey bees in Californian almond orchards because it does something honey bees cannot: fly in the cold wet weather that February almond bloom routinely brings. A few hundred females will pollinate an orchard acre as effectively as a full honey bee colony, and they are sold as cocoons in a box.
- Italian honey beeApis mellifera ligusticaThe most widely kept honey bee subspecies in the world, and the golden-banded bee most people picture when they think of one. Italian bees were exported from the Ligurian valleys from the mid nineteenth century and now underpin commercial beekeeping across the Americas, Australasia and much of Europe — chosen for gentleness, prolific brood rearing and a strong disinclination to swarm.
- Carpenter beesXylocopaThe largest bees most people ever see, and among the loudest. Carpenter bees excavate their own tunnels in dead wood using their mandibles — a remarkable feat for an insect — and the biggest species are the size of the top joint of a thumb. The violet carpenter bee, glossy black with iridescent blue-violet wings, is one of the most spectacular insects in Europe and is spreading northwards.
Honey in Portugal
Rosmaninho — Lavandula stoechas, the Portuguese lavender — gives a honey that is a regional staple and quite distinct from French lavender honey, and it is the clearest case of a Portuguese monofloral that does not travel under its own name.
